About Be A Mentor!
The cornerstone of Seedling's service model is the creation of an enduring relationship between a caring and responsible volunteer adult role model and the child of an incarcerated parent. Significant efforts are taken to create, sustain, and advance each relationship. Seedling's Mentor Program focuses on children in grades K-8 who are matched with a trained volunteer from the community who meets one day a week with the child at school during their lunchtime for a full academic school year. Seedling is committed to serving each student and each matched relationship for as long as possible, even throughout high school.
Application Process
Please contact Seedling if you are interested in being a mentor to a child who has been impacted by parental incarceration. An application, references, and background check are required.
